Bird Feeders
Throughout the year we feed the birds. A well balanced mixture of seeds on the bird tray, and suet cakes hung in a plastic mesh bag, attract a wide variety of our feathered friends. Cardinals, the bright red feathers of the male and the blue feathers of the Blue Jay are a welcome splashes of colour against the snow in Winter. Chickadees and nuthatch flit back and forth choosing only the smallest of seeds. Morning Doves, eat their fill and then just sit fluffing up their feathers to keep warm.
Flickers and wood peckers prefer the seed cakes, tapping their beaks against the frozen suet.
Seeds that fall are then eaten by the black and grey squirrels.
Now the warmer weather is here, we noticed the Yellow Finch are now looking for their favourite, Niger seed, so we filled the feeder for them. The robins have returned and looking for worms and bugs.

I belong to a local quilting guild and for the past few years we have had a fabric challenge, and this year was no exception. At our October meeting each member was asked to bring one yard of a batik fabric. We all stood in a circle, we folded our fabric in half, snipped it on the fold and ripped it. One piece was dropped on the floor and the other was passed to the person on our right. We continue this process with each piece of fabric which was passed to us until we had seven pieces of fabric. Each piece got progressively smaller. We then had until March to make something, our choice, however, the project had to include at least one piece of each fabric.
The reveal was at our March meeting, we have a very talented group of woman, bags, wall hangings, runners and a pillow were the results of this challenge. This is my wall hanging.
